Moving a few blocks away might seem simple enough for a DIY approach, but the hidden complexities quickly add up. Renting a truck, hauling heavy furniture down stairs, and squeezing a couch through narrow doorframes often leads to strained backs and wasted weekends. Local movers arrive with the right tools—dollies, furniture pads, and ramps—and the muscle memory to navigate tricky layouts. They complete in three hours what would take a full day of sweat and second-guessing. That speed means you spend less time exhausted and more time settling into your new space.

Why Local Movers Outperform DIY Efforts Every Time

The core reason you should trust long distance moving company over a DIY move is risk management. A rental truck offers no insurance for a dropped TV or a scratched hardwood floor; your security deposit vanishes with one wrong turn. Local movers carry liability coverage and worker’s compensation, so a dented wall or a broken lamp becomes their problem, not yours. They also know the quirks of your neighborhood—parking permits, elevator scheduling, and the fastest route around one-way streets. DIY moving leaves you to discover these pitfalls alone, often at 6 PM when the truck is blocking traffic and your friends have gone home.

The Real Cost and Stress Savings

Financial math also favors the professionals. DIY moving hides costs: truck rental per mile, gas, tape and boxes, pizza for helpers, and possible damage repairs. Local movers quote one flat, transparent fee. More importantly, they eliminate the emotional toll—the last-minute panic of an overloaded truck, the awkward strain on friendships, and the sleepless night before returning the vehicle. Hiring local movers turns moving day into a scheduled, orderly process. You wake up in your old home and go to sleep in your new one, with nothing lost, broken, or regretted. For a local shift, that peace of mind is priceless.
